env: /etc/init.d/mysqld: 没有那个文件或目录
时间: 2023-09-08 08:15:01 浏览: 59
这个错误可能是因为 MySQL 服务没有被正确安装或没有正确配置。
首先,你可以尝试查看 MySQL 是否已经安装。你可以在终端使用以下命令来检查 MySQL 是否安装:
```
mysql --version
```
如果输出了 MySQL 版本号,则说明 MySQL 已经安装。如果没有输出,则说明 MySQL 没有安装。
如果MySQL已经安装,那么你可以尝试重新启动 MySQL 服务:
```
sudo service mysql restart
```
如果 MySQL 服务已经启动,但是你仍然无法连接到 MySQL 数据库,那么你可以尝试检查 MySQL 配置文件是否正确。
MySQL 配置文件通常位于 `/etc/mysql/mysql.conf.d/mysqld.cnf` 或 `/etc/my.cnf`。你可以编辑这个文件并确保 MySQL 正在监听正确的端口,并且允许远程连接(如果需要)。
如果你不确定如何编辑 MySQL 配置文件,可以参考官方文档或者咨询 MySQL 社区。
相关问题
env: /etc/init.d/mysqld: Permission denied service mysqld start
您好!对于权限被拒绝的问题,可能是由于您没有足够的权限来启动mysqld服务。您可以尝试使用sudo命令来以管理员身份运行该命令。请尝试以下命令:
```bash
sudo service mysqld start
```
这将要求您输入管理员密码,然后尝试启动mysqld服务。如果您没有sudo权限,请联系系统管理员以获取帮助。希望能对您有所帮助!如果您有其他问题,请随时提问。
env: /etc/init.d/ss5: 权限不够
这个错误提示是因为您没有足够的权限执行 `/etc/init.d/ss5` 这个文件。您可以尝试以下方法来解决这个问题:
1. 以超级用户(root)身份登录服务器,然后再执行该命令。例如:`sudo su -`,然后输入 root 用户密码。
2. 使用sudo命令以超级用户身份执行该命令。例如:`sudo /etc/init.d/ss5 restart`,然后输入您的用户密码。
3. 如果您已经拥有sudo权限,但依然无法执行该命令,请检查一下 `/etc/sudoers` 文件中是否已经正确配置了您的sudo权限。
希望这些解决方法能够帮到您。